Senate Passes Bennet, Ayotte Bipartisan Bill to Open Membership in Blue Star Mothers to More Family Members of Our Heroes

Bill Helps More Mothers of Military Service Members Join Support and Service Organization

The US. Senate has passed a bipartisan bill sponsored by U.S. Senators Michael Bennet (D-CO) and Kelly Ayotte (R-NH) to expand membership in Blue Star Mothers of America to more mothers of current or former military service members. The bill passed with broad bipartisan support. Blue Star Mothers of America is a congressionally-...

Bill to Repeal Defense of Marriage Act Clears Key Committee Hurdle

Bennet Applauds Judiciary Committee Approval as Key Step Toward Marriage Equality

Colorado U.S. Senator Michael Bennet released the following statement after the Senate Judiciary Committee approved the Respect for Marriage Act – which would repeal the Defense of Marriage Act (DOMA) – by a vote of 10 to 8. He is a cosponsor of the bill. “The repeal of DOMA is long overdue,” Bennet said. ...
